HVAC efficiency is essential for owners seeking to optimize their vitality consumption and cut back utility payments. A well-functioning HVAC system ensures that your house remains snug throughout the year. However, poorly maintained methods can quickly turn into vitality guzzlers, driving up prices and impacting indoor air quality.


Regular maintenance of your HVAC system is the cornerstone of efficiency. Scheduling annual inspections with a professional technician helps determine potential issues before they become important issues. During these inspections, technicians can clean essential components, verify refrigerant ranges, and ensure that all settings are functioning correctly. Regular maintenance additionally extends the lifespan of your system, thereby saving you cash in the long run.

Changing air filters is one other simple yet effective method to improve HVAC efficiency. Filters entice mud, dirt, and allergens, which can impede airflow. When airflow is restricted, your system has to work more durable to chill or heat your home. This pressure can result in overheating and untimely system failure. Most experts recommend replacing or cleaning filters every one to 3 months, relying on utilization and filter sort.


Keeping out of doors items free from particles is crucial for optimum performance. Grass, leaves, and other supplies can accumulate around the out of doors unit, severely hindering its efficiency. Ensure that there's sufficient clearance around the unit to permit for sufficient airflow. Regularly checking and cleaning the world round your HVAC unit helps keep its efficiency.

Sealing gaps and cracks in your house can even improve overall HVAC efficiency. Air leaks round home windows, doorways, and other openings enable conditioned air to flee. This can lead to your system working overtime to maintain the specified temperature. Using caulk or climate stripping can effectively seal these gaps, making your home extra energy-efficient and cozy.

These gadgets allow you to set completely different temperatures for various occasions of the day, which might lead to substantial power financial savings. For example, decreasing the temperature when you are not home and elevating it earlier than you return can make a giant distinction in energy consumption.


Consider upgrading to a high-efficiency HVAC system in case your current one is outdated. Modern HVAC items are equipped with advanced expertise that improves their efficiency while decreasing power consumption. Energy Efficiency Ratio (EER) and Seasonal Energy Efficiency Ratio (SEER) rankings can guide your purchasing selections. Higher rankings point out more efficient methods, which might result in long-term savings.

By dividing your personal home into zones that could be heated or cooled independently, you'll be able to avoid losing power on unused areas. This strategy permits for personalised consolation and may considerably lower your vitality bills.

Investing in energy-efficient windows can even have a notable impact on your HVAC efficiency. Windows that are double or triple-glazed assist insulate your own home, minimizing heat transfer. This means your HVAC system won’t should work as hard to take care of snug temperatures, thus consuming much less energy.


Incorporating ceiling fans into your home can help in circulating air extra effectively. During warmer months, ceiling fans can create a wind-chill impact, permitting you to lift the thermostat setting with out feeling uncomfortable. In colder months, reversing the fan direction helps push warm air down from the ceiling. This dual performance means a extra environment friendly use of your HVAC system year-round.

Monitoring humidity ranges in your home is one other important side of HVAC efficiency. High humidity can make your home feel hotter than it truly is, prompting the system to cool greater than needed. A dehumidifier can be an effective solution for managing humidity, preserving your house comfy while visit the website reducing the workload in your HVAC system.


Regularly check the ductwork for any obstructions or leaks that would diminish your system's performance. Dirty or poorly insulated ducts can lead to heated or cooled air escaping earlier than it reaches its meant room. Seal any leaks with sturdy tape or mastic, and consider cleansing ductwork every few years to make sure unobstructed airflow.

What SEER ranking ought to I look for when purchasing a model new air conditioner?undefinedThe Seasonal Energy Efficiency Ratio (SEER) measures air conditioning efficiency. A greater SEER rating indicates higher efficiency. Homeowners should aim for a SEER rating of at least 14 for good performance, whereas sixteen or higher is considered glorious.


How typically should I change my HVAC filters?undefinedIt's typically beneficial to change your HVAC filters each 1 to three months, depending on utilization, filter sort, and household situations (like pet presence or allergies). Regularly changing filters improves airflow and system efficiency.


What can I do to make sure my HVAC system is correctly maintained?undefinedRegular maintenance contains scheduling annual professional inspections, cleaning coils, checking refrigerant levels, and ensuring all components are functioning correctly. Consistent maintenance prevents breakdowns and keeps your system running efficiently.
